About this ebook
The book examines, country by country, the failures of European legal and political institutions that contributed to and led up to the Brexit vote. An Island Apart is a great resource to lawyers who practice international law and businesspeople dealing with the U.K. and the E.U.
Many titles covering this topic focus on a micro-level on the behind-the-scenes political machinations and maneuvering in the build-up to the June 2016 Brexit referendum. An Island Apart looks at the subject from a more macro-European perspective, focusing on the failure of European legal and political institutions in the years leading up to the BREXIT vote, and attempts to put the historic decision into broader contexts for American readers.
